Leveraging Advanced CNC Controls for Precise and Repeatable Bending

Precision is no longer negotiable; it’s expected. Ermaksan’s advanced CNC control systems put exact control in your operator’s hands while reducing the potential for human error. These controls offer easy-to-understand touchscreens and offline programming tools that allow operators to program, test, and adjust jobs with confidence, minimizing trial-and-error downtime.

For complex multi-bend parts, Ermaksan CNC-driven systems automatically calculate and adjust backgauge positions, bend sequences, and even compensation for material spring-back. This repeatability means managers can send new or experienced operators to the same press brake and expect consistently high-quality output.

The ability to import designs directly from CAD files or digital templates also speeds up changeovers and reduces programming time. That way, smaller lot sizes or frequent job switches don’t drag down overall throughput. For shops hungry for efficiency, Ermaksan’s Delem or ESA S640 CNC controls can help standardize production processes and reduce reliance on highly skilled, but scarce, press brake experts.

Maximizing Throughput with Automated Backgauge and Tooling Systems

High-capacity bending is all about minimizing setup and cycle times. Ermaksan addresses this with automated backgauge systems that position material quickly and precisely for each bend. Up to six or more CNC axes allow for intricate and multi-directional forming, making rapid adjustments for each part geometry on the fly.

Quick tool change setups and smart hydraulic clamping further cut downtime. Operators can slide and lock tooling into place in seconds instead of minutes, reducing bottlenecks where skilled labor or crane time would otherwise be needed. When combined with a modular tooling library, job sequences become faster and misalignments are all but eliminated.

Enhancing Material Flow and Operator Safety in High-Capacity Environments

Moving large, heavy, or awkward sheets through a high-volume bending station can quickly become a material handling headache. Ermaksan offers several solutions, from front and side sheet supports to robust, ergonomic loading tables that make operator tasks safer and more efficient. This reduces both fatigue and the chance of error, especially on longer parts commonly found in architectural, enclosure, or structural fabrication.

Integrated safety systems — such as light curtains, hands-free foot pedals, and safety PLCs — create a working environment where productivity doesn’t come at the expense of operator protection. These features keep work flowing by ensuring the press brake operates only when all safety criteria are met, virtually eliminating the risk of costly accidents or stoppages.

Efficient material flow is further supported by features like automatic part return, so finished bends are ejected or offloaded with minimal manual handling. This allows the shop to dedicate fewer hands per job, streamlining labor costs and freeing up experienced workers for more critical tasks elsewhere.
